What ICIS Covers Across Markets
ICIS provides in-depth visibility into commodity prices, transaction data, and regulatory developments that shape energy and chemical markets. The scope of coverage helps organizations benchmark performance and anticipate shifts before they affect margins.
| Market Area | Key Commodities & Products | Primary Regions | Decision Support Use |
|---|---|---|---|
| Energy | Natural gas, crude oil, refined products, power | Europe, North America, Asia Pacific | >Portfolio optimization, hedging, regulatory impact |
| Chemicals | Petrochemicals, solvents, surfactants, polymers | Global with regional pricing grids | Feedstock strategy, cracker and derivative planning |
| Plastics | PE, PP, PVC, PET, engineering resins | Global trade regions and key importing markets | Cost benchmarking, contract negotiation, margin protection |
| Fertilizers & Metals | Urea, ammonia, ammonia derivatives, key base metals | Regional market clusters and trade routes | Supply risk assessment, cost modeling, procurement timing |

How does ICIS ensure price data accuracy and transparency?
ICIS validates transaction data through direct supplier and buyer confirmations, applies consistent geography and currency adjustments, and documents methodology so users can trace how each assessment is calculated and updated.
